Fossil fuels will be banned from new and remodeled federal buildings under a rule finalized by the Department of Energy this week. The rule stems from the Energy Independence and Security Act of 2007 (EISA). The EISA mandate was not fully effected until now because the DoE never finalized its regulations, NPR reported a year ago.
